		<description><![CDATA[There are more than 500 million domestic cats in the world with many different breeds. The International Progressive Cat Breeders Alliance (IPCBA) recognizes 73 cat breeds, while the more conservative Cat Fanciers&#8217; Association (CFA) recognizes only 41.
